Just now, carpanfan96 said:

I know last year during spring practice that Ridley ran a 4.35 at Alabama. I expect him to show up with a 4.4 during drills. 

You have to take those spring 40s with a grain of salt.

Robert Quinn broke Peppers 40 time in a spring practice but was a 4.7

Funchess and KB has fast reported spring r0s and was complete different.

A lot of scouts project him as avg 4.5 creeping to 4.45 but some think faster.  He is the best route runner in the class and among the top in concentration.

He runs a 4.35 he could shoot into the top 15. He runs a 4.5 (with those measurments) he could fall to the bottom of the 1st being jumped by 1-2 other WRs
